The cast and crew of “Frankenstein” are still being spotted around the city! The movie’s director, award-winning filmmaker Guillermo Del Toro, was most recently seen out and about in Toronto at Vinegar Syndrome – a “brick & mortar film/music shop curating all things physical media.” Here’s what we know.

Del Toro took to social media to share the shopping trip with his followers writing, “Shopping at Vinegar Syndrome 399 Roncesvalles in Toronto- great Shop!! Did some damage!” 

The west end Toronto store returned the love by posting its own photo with the filmmaker, captioning it, “Just an absolute pleasure, every time. We love you too, @gdtreal.”

This isn’t the first time Del Toro’s posted about being in Toronto either!

On January 26th, he shared another photo seemingly on the set of “Frankenstein” writing, “Toronto, the studio, this week. Looks like somebody parked in my spot.”

Some of the cast and crew were also spotted around the same time at the popular Northern Thai restaurant Pai, with the restaurant sharing a photo on social media featuring Mia Goth, Christoph Waltz, Charles Dance, and Oscar Issac.
